F2 Logistics parts ways with Tine Tiamzon, five others


F2 Logistics has opted not to renew six players heading into the 2023 Premier Volleyball League season.

The most surprising of which was Tine Tiamzon.

Tiamzon, a 25-year-old outside hitter, decided to forgo her final year with De La Salle University last year to join F2.

The Filipino-Canadian spiker suffered a right knee injury during F2 Logistics’ clash against Cignal back on November 19, 2022.

Another surprising release was Des Clemente.

Clemente, 26, has been a mainstay with F2 Logistics since her one-and-done stint with La Salle back in UAAP Season 81.

Also not renewed was Dzi Gervacio, who went to F2 Logistics after Perlas disbanded last season.

F2 Logistics also bid farewell to Alex Cabanos, Rem Cailing, and Chloe Cortez.

Cabanos retired from the game mid-last year. Meanwhile, Cailing and Cortez signed with F2 Logistics back in 2021.

F2 Logistics, a decorated team in the defunct Philippine Superliga, has yet to make the semis in the PVL.
